Four law firms have picked up roles to advise on the acquisition of a U.S. pest control company by a U.K. rival in a transaction worth $6.7 billion.

Wachtell, Lipton, Rosen & Katz and Macfarlanes are advising U.S. business Terminix on its acquisition by FTSE 100 company Rentokil, creating one of the world’s largest pest control companies in a tie-up worth $6.7 billion, according to a market statement from Rentokil on Tuesday.
